Literature summary for 3.1.3.48 extracted from

  • Puius, Y.A.; Zhao, Y.; Sullivan, M.; Lawrence, D.S.; Almo, S.C.; Zhang, Z.Y.
    Identification of a second aryl phosphate-binding site in protein-tyrosine phosphatase 1B: a paradigm for inhibitor design (1997), Proc. Natl. Acad. Sci. USA, 94, 13420-13425.

Reaction

Reaction Comment Organism Reaction ID
[a protein]-tyrosine phosphate + H2O = [a protein]-tyrosine + phosphate in addition to active site, enzyme has a low-affinity noncatalytic aryl phosphate-binding site Homo sapiens
